Research Snapshot

AstraZeneca PLC (AZNCF) is a Healthcare stock with a market cap of $294.40B. The stock last traded around $189.90 and up 42.8% across the available one-year price window (Jun 23, 2025 โ†’ Apr 6, 2026). Baseline metrics include revenue growth of +8.6%, EPS growth of +45.4%, a dividend yield of 1.8%. What stands out right now is revenue +8.6%, EPS +45.4%, free cash flow +19.2% with operating margin 23.5% and ROIC 12.9%. The dividend is present but secondary, with a yield around 1.8%. Valuation sits in the middle of the pack at P/E 26.9 and price/sales 4.6.
